For that weight class I wouldn't have picked anything but large-tube aluminum, specifically a Cannondale. There might be some difficulty in meeting your price range, but asking is free. How tall are you? Have a weight goal? Going to ride more?

My 240 lb high-mileage friends are reporting very good results with the Shimano 540 paired-spoke wheels: no truing at two years, and they don't break. Those likely are out of your price range for a whole bike, but their success suggests to me that you do not have to get wheels of conventional construction when others are doing better.
